Pray for the sight of an open door (a villanelle) by Molly G. (’23)

Be careful what you wish for

A girl remembers a time when she would run and play

Pray for the sight of an open door

 

Darkness and gloom shadow over in a bore

A girl is cuffed to her chair to stay

Be careful what you wish for

 

Clinging to the memory of before

A girl dazes out the window as the rain pours and the sky grey

Pray for the sight of an open door

 

Death and destruction with loneliness at the core

A girl forgets that each morning is a dying day

Be careful what you wish for

 

Locked inside, wishing I could do more

A girl worries about family across the way

Pray for the sight of an open door

 

Feeling powerless in this war

A girl sleeps because in her dreams everything is okay

Be careful what you wish for

Pray for the sight of an open door
